Winning the Lotto — Lucky or Not?
If you happen to be a lotto winner your life is never going to be the same again. Not only your life, but the lives of friends and relatives will also change — and the change may not always be pleasant. Life-changing things have happened to people who have suddenly attained the status of being a lotto winner.

Mark Gardiner won a record prize of £ 11 million and believed that all his problems were a thing of the past. However, though his current problems vanished, he got into new ones that he was neither trained for or capable of handling. Mark hit the jackpot with business partner and friend Paul Maddison. Together the two of them won a record £ 22 million; Mark’s share was £ 11 million. Paul shunned the limelight and faded into the background — but Mark decided to have some fun.
Before he could understand it, Mark blew half of his winnings. Even as he bought expensive cars and houses, gave to friends and relatives, married and then divorced, his problems never seemed to end. His family rejected him as though he had committed a crime. Finally he regained his bearings and is now wiser and remarried to his first wife, a childhood sweetheart, whom he had divorced when he was penniless.
Happily, however, not all stories are as heart breaking as the one mentioned above. There have been a great many people who have made good on their fortune and remained grounded. Ianthe Fullagar, just a student, won an astonishing £ 7,055,142. After the understandable screaming in disbelief she settled down and called her family, and her boyfriend, and shared the news with them. Ianthe intends to share her new found wealth with her near ones and continues to pursue her studies in law school. A new car was the only new thing she planned to buy.
An anonymous winner donated all his $3 million winnings to his church without batting an eye. The church has decided to expand to accommodate its growing congregation; they will also donate some of the money to charities.
The point is as a lotto winner you are in an enviable position to do a lot of good to benefit yourself and to benefit those around you. Your community will benefit too — if you maintain a cool head and spend the money wisely.
